Neurotrauma and Critical Care of the Brain

Christopher M. Loftus , Jack Jallo

editore: Thieme Medical Publishers Inc

pagine: 496

In Neurotrauma and Critical Care of the Brain, leading clinicians present widely accepted guidelines and evidence-based practices for the management of patients with traumatic brain injury. Divided into five main sections, the book guides the clinician through the science, management, critical care, outcomes, and important socioeconomic issues relevant to patient care. Special Features: * Offers the valuable team approach and recommendations of renowned surgeons, clinicians, rehabilitation specialists, and researchers * Includes guidelines for injuries ranging from mild to moderate, severe, and penetrating, and for treating brain injury in children * Covers the related intensive care issues of neurologic, pulmonary, cardiovascular, and infection management and nutrition and fluid control * Reviews fundamental science concepts, including pathophysiology, monitoring and imaging, biomarkers and classification systems for brain injury * Provides hundreds of concise summary tables and illustrations to help digest complex information * Discusses ethics and important end-of-life issues With an integrated management approach to injury and rehabilitation that goes well beyond initial surgery, Neurotrauma and Critical Care of the Brain will enable neurosurgeons, neurologists, physicians in trauma, critical care, and rehabilitation medicine, and residents in these specialties to optimize patient care and outcomes. It is also useful as a guide for board exam preparation. The companion volume to this book is Neurotrauma and Critical Care of the Spine.

Neurotrauma and Critical Care of the Spine

Alexander R. Vaccaro , Jack Jallo

editore: Thieme Medical Publishers Inc

pagine: 256

Neurotrauma and Critical Care of the Spine provides a concise review of the current surgical interventions and medical treatments for patients with traumatic spine injuries. Experts in the fields of neurosurgery and orthopedic surgery lead clinicians through each stage of patient care, from prehospital care to initial assessment to diagnostic work up and finally through operative and nonoperative treatments. The book places special emphasis on critical care of the patient and provides insight into future techniques for management. Features: * Review of fundamental science concepts, including pathophysiology, spinal cord regeneration, and the biomechanics of the spine * Guidelines for selecting appropriate imaging modalities and administering diagnostic tests, such as electrophysiological studies * Thorough descriptions of preoperative evaluation and medical optimization of the patient * Chapters covering such important topics as pediatric management, multidisciplinary approaches to rehabilitation and recovery, socioeconomic issues, and ethical issues * Summary tables that synthesize the literature and provide an overview of treatment options * More than 130 high-quality illustrations demonstrating key concepts Guiding clinicians from assessment through rehabilitation, this book presents a comprehensive, multidisciplinary approach that will enable neurosurgeons, orthopedic surgeons, trauma and emergency specialists, and residents in these specialties to optimize patient care. The companion volume to this book is Neurotrauma and Critical Care of the Brain .
